[3/3,media] s5p-fimc: Replace printk with pr_* functions
Commit Message
Hi Sachin,
On 06/11/2012 12:13 PM, Sachin Kamat wrote:
> Replace printk with pr_* functions to silence checkpatch warnings.
>
> Signed-off-by: Sachin Kamat<sachin.kamat@linaro.org>
> ---
> drivers/media/video/s5p-fimc/fimc-core.h | 2 +-
> 1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/media/video/s5p-fimc/fimc-core.h b/drivers/media/video/s5p-fimc/fimc-core.h
> index 95b27ae..c22fb0a 100644
> --- a/drivers/media/video/s5p-fimc/fimc-core.h
> +++ b/drivers/media/video/s5p-fimc/fimc-core.h
> @@ -28,7 +28,7 @@
> #include<media/s5p_fimc.h>
>
> #define err(fmt, args...) \
> - printk(KERN_ERR "%s:%d: " fmt "\n", __func__, __LINE__, ##args)
> + pr_err("%s:%d: " fmt "\n", __func__, __LINE__, ##args)
I don't think it's worth the effort. If you really want to get rid
of that warnings, please remove the err() macro altogether and
do something like this instead:
